L'Oreal Paris Voluminous Miss Manga Mascara

One of my beauty weaknesses is mascara. I will always want a new mascara. Doesn't matter how good the one I have is or how many new ones I have, I am always in need of a new one. Believe it or not but you usually have one for every occasion too. There is always that one that makes your lashes look SUPER OUT THERE and those are for special occasions and then you go into the ones that have specific needs like volume, length, curl, black, brown, colored. There are just so many different types of mascaras you can have so I always like to try new ones. One drugstore brand that I can say usually has really good mascaras is Loreal. One of my most favorite ones is the Loreal Voluminous mascara. This is an oldie but goodie. It just does everything you need for a mascara to do. It gives you volume, length and everything. The brush is great on it, before all the plastic brushes started being popular, that mascara did quite well with just its regular bristle brush one.

Loreal just released a Voluminous Miss Manga mascara. I did not pick this up right away. I have to say I didn't really think to get this because of the brush. The brush that it had was triangle brush that looked like the one from the MakeUp Forever Smoky Extravagant mascara that I honestly didn't like. The only real visual difference between the two is that the brush bends and the base of the brush. Not sure what that's all about so this is why I hesitated in purchasing. But as always I read a lot of reviews and watched a couple of YouTube videos and time after time everyone fell in love with it. I was hooked and went right away to buy it.

I tried it in the Blackest Black color they have and O-M-G it's amazing! It separates your
lashes and makes them long. Not sure if they curl my lashes but since I have long lashes, I'm not too crazy about mascaras actually doing that because I feel like it would get mascara all over my brow line. I do like volume so that it makes my lashes look thicker and it does do this not as well as other ones I tried but between the way it separates your lashes the product is a really good one. I am definitely hooked with this mascara. I still don't understand what the bendable wand does. I don't feel like it really adds or takes away from the application but it's ok. When you first put it on, you don't feel like you are getting product onto your lashes but once you have a couple of swipes your lashes look amazing.

This is a drugstore mascara so it retails for about $8.99 which is nothing compared to other ones out there. You can find this is most drugstores and Walmarts and Targets. I definitely recommend you going out to buy this!! You won't regret it.

Tarte Maracuja Creaseless Concealer

I think its my calling to be an all knowing beauty expert. Whenever I go into the drugstore or Sephora or even department stores, I always look around and think.. hmm what can I blog about next. I always want to try the next best thing. One of the things that I feel I am always on the search for is mascara, concealer and foundation. I feel you can never stick to just one. Everytime I go to +Sephora I always ask them about concealers. I feel like this is one thing that I haven't really found that I can totally live without. I have oily skin but under my eyes is very dry and tends to crease in an instant. I've tried everything under the sun and I just want something that works. Recently I've been hooked on Armani's Maestro Eraser Concealer and I really felt that it was hydrating and I really do love it. I feel that the sheen in it brightens the area and I really like the feel of it on my skin. I went to +Sephora in Herald Square last week and asked about the Tarte Maracuja creaseless concealer and the lady that helped me was completely in love with it. She was saying how she also had oily skin and that her skin was the same as mine and she said that the Maestro one didn't cover as much and that the Tarte one was way better since it was full coverage. 


This concealer is said to be full coverage and it won't crease, flake or have you needing to reapply. It has +tarte's signature maracuja oil in it which helped improve your skin's texture, tone and moisture while having a brightening dewy luminous finish. Since it has the maracuja oil, you will see that it also has all the benefits that you will find in the regular maracuja oil and the actual concealer will help mask any discoloration, imperfections such as acne, blemishes, redness, scars, hyperpigmentation and even dark circles. Its very easy to apply. Even though its full coverage, you will notice that its really easy to blend and it dries to a flawless finish. 

I asked for a sample and took it home to try it. The next morning I put on my foundation and then the concealer. I used a concealer brush since that's what she recommended. I liked how it went on at first and yes I did feel that it did cover better than the Maestro one. The true test for me is throughout the day. I was thinking that this stuff will probably crease within seconds. I went throughout the entire day and nothing. I didn't feel it crease at all. We are in summer so if anything it was going to crease instantly during the summer months but it stayed put. At the end of the day, I didn't feel that my concealer had disappeared or anything or that I needed more coverage throughout the day.

This concealer retails for $24 which is way cheaper than the Maestro Eraser concealer. This concealer also comes in 7 different shades ranging from fair to dark. The shade I chose for myself is medium but there are a range of different shades that you can choose from. All in all, I definitely recommend this product along with this brand. I don't think there has been a product from this brand that I haven't fell in love with. Its definitely something you should pick up.

Trish McEvoy Instant Eye Lift™ Review

After my post from yesterday I figured I'd give you more information on Trish McEvoy products. This is a luxury brand and everything about this makeup line feels like luxury. I know you've probably never heard of this brand before my post from yesterday. If you haven't read it, you can just scroll down and see that there I talk about their eyebrow pencils. I know this brand isn't one of the popular ones but I think its because its not a cheap brand. Like I said before for sure this is one of those luxury brands that are sold mostly in +Bloomingdale's  and +Nordstrom. Most of the products in this makeup line isn't something that can't be found in another brand like the eyebrow pencil that I reviewed yesterday which you can find in +Sephora under the Anastasia Beverly Hills brand which was only about $7 cheaper so its not that much of a difference. One of the other products that they showed us that night we went on that makeup event was an Instant Eye Lift. This is like an eyeshadow primer. It only comes in 2 colors light/medium and tan/dark. This makes it really easy to choose what color is the right one for you. I got the light/medium color and the minute you put this on your eyes you see how it brightens your eyes immediately. It is used on your eyelids from your lash line to the browline and instantly you will see your eyes will be more open, brighter and it does actually give your eyes an instant lift. 

You can either use this alone or you can use under your eyeshadows. This product will make your eyeshadows stay on longer and not crease throughout the day. Since its a light color it will also give your eyeshadow a base where so that your eyeshadows look brighter. This product does wonders for those people that have uneven skin tone around the eye area. The brighter your eyes are the more awake you will look. This will help your appearance completely. This product is said to be a line filler which will make your eyes look younger and brighter and the appearance of your wrinkles will be less visible. This is long wearing and will definitely last through the day. I love using this product when I try to just go for a plain look, no makeup look and just have maybe a bold lip. When I do a bold lip I try to go with a plain eye but plain doesn't mean that I don't wear any makeup, I just tone it down. This product retails for $38 which is a hefty price for an eye primer but its definitely more than that. I do like this product but not sure if I would repurchase because it is one of those luxury products.

Giorgio Armani Maestro Eraser Concealer

As you know I've been in the eternal search for a perfect under eye concealer. I've been searching and searching and have always come up short handed. My issue with concealers is that even though my skin is oily but the skin under my eyes is very dry. This is the biggest issue that I have. I also have dark circles under my eyes due to genetics. thanks Mom! So all in all what I look for in a concealer is something that is hydrating , has good coverage and something that won't crease throughout the day. I went to +Sephora one day and all I wanted to get out of that trip was a concealer that would solve all of my problems. I proceeded to tell the representative at +Sephora that I need something that will hide my dark circles, brighten up the area and also something that is hydrating. I proceeded to also explain my skincare routine so that she understands that I take care of my skin and I do use eye cream, moisturizers and I also use Panda's Dream Good-Bye Dark Eye Corrector so this adds extra moisture but even with all that it doesn't stop from the concealer from creasing and looking dry.

The representative looked at my eyes and immediately knew that I needed the Giorgio Armani Maestro Eraser Concealer. She explained that it was the most hydrating concealer that they have in Sephora and that it is one of the best out there. It retails for $42 so for concealer it better be good. Since I've heard this sales tactic a lot I opted for a sample. The color they gave me was the exact color to my skin usually I go for something lighter so that it can brighten my skin but I used it and immediately felt that it was liquidy. It also had shimmer in it. That didn't stop me from using it. I usually apply my concealer after the foundation so thats what I did and with my Beauty Blender.  I sealed it with the ELF under eye brightening setting powder and went on my way. The coverage was great and I liked how it felt on my skin since it was so hydrating. The real test is once I have it on throughout the day. I got home and it passed the test. I noticed immediately that the coverage was better than anything I've tried in the past and it didn't crease as much as I thought it would. I'm glad I tried this and I've been using it ever since. I tried it before even reading the reviews which was a bad thing because I probably would have bought it sooner had I known how amazing it was. It says its a hybrid concealer that combines makeup and skincare with its fine texture that it has. The illuminating concealer instantly brightens the eye area and it will even gradually fade away the blue tone of dark circles and moisturize eyelids to enhance your eyes and make your overall face look more radiant. If your eyes look amazing then the rest of your face will look amazing. I know it has a price of $42 but between covering up the dark circles and actually gradually fading them over time, I think its worth every penny.

Benefit They're Real Eye MakeUp Line

For those who know me, you know I am a sucker for a bold lip and an amazing mascara. I try a lot of different mascaras. I try from drugstore to premium brands like Benefit. Some brands are worth the pricier price tags but some you would be shocked that they are so cheap. One of my favorite mascaras is from Benefit. This is definitely a higher end mascara. You can find it in +Sephora. This mascara has a great wand. It separates your lashes like no other. It has more of that plastic brush and it has a ball on the end so that you can get in those inner and outer corners. The formula is great and it really does make your eyelashes look like they are fake.

Benefit just started to add to this fabulous collection. They recently added an eyeliner and an eye makeup remover. This is great since the mascara is so amazing already the brand and product line is already off to a great start. The eyeliner is for those girls that love that eyeliner that is just perfect. This liner is in a gel like pen form. In the past, you were either to get the pencil form or the gel form which you can apply with an angled brush. Benefit doesn't stop to amaze me with their products. A pen gel formula eyeliner. The tip has more of a rubberized feel and all you have to do is click up and dispense the gel. This formula enables you to be able to hug your lash line to give you that perfect liner look. Since it has a pen applicator, you can get a perfect cat eye and winged look. I am a total amature with the cat eye or winged look but with this liner, it will definitely make it easier to do. I am going to still need practice to avoid looking like a panda bear but if I am going to learn, this liner is probably the best one to learn with. 

Benefit is also adding a eye makeup remover which is perfect since trying to get all this stuff off your eyes is usually a challenge. They managed to create a balm like eye makeup remover. This is going to be great to remove all the eyeliner and mascara. This doesn't debut until June but I am already looking forward to this launch. The eyeliner will retail for $24 and the eye makeup remover will retail for $18 and for those who are interested in getting the mascara now, that retails for $23.

Make Up For Ever Smoky Extravagant Mascara

I recently got makeup organizers for my vanity so everything that I have is nicely
organized. Easy to access and since everything isn't on top of each other I am able to find things easier. This helps me rediscover makeup that I have that I forgot about. I recently started using other mascaras just to say I use all 10 of the ones I currently own. I had received a Make Up For Ever Smoky Extravagant mascara I think as a birthday gift from +Sephora and I saw the wand and it was a bit intimidating. It is shaped as a 'v' so its very pointy at the end and then very fat at the other side closest to the wand. The brush was something that I've never seen before and it was a bit intimidating. I always heard good things about the Make Up For Ever brand so I was happy to get this as a gift to try it. 


This mascara is suppose to add volume, length and curl your lashes. This is a bold claim for a mascara. I've been using it for about a week now and I thought it would have been a different experience. The formula isn't bad. I hate trying new mascaras because the product is just everywhere. I hate to have so much gunk on my wand that it just makes my eyelashes clump up and it just turns into a huge mess. I usually have to go in with a eye lashes separator and clean it up and then clean my eye lid. Its just a mess over all. This mascara didn't have that which was amazing but I did feel that I didn't get enough product or maybe the brush was too hard and didn't really separate my lashes as much as I wanted. The angled brush was a bit weird in applying. Also I am right handed and usually just apply mascara with the same hand but this one since it has a specific angle to the brush, it was like you had to use the specific hand for the specific eye and honestly I don't have time for that. It didn't do anything that it claimed to do. It simply just put product on my eyelashes. I needed to curl them, separate them and it didn't add more length that what I already have. It wasn't too bad but its definitely not a mascara that I would purchase and rave about like its the best thing since sliced bread. I think I've fallen in love with other mascaras that are drugstore purchases. This mascara retails for $24 and you can find it in +Sephora. For that price, I definitely do not recommend it, unless you are a person that likes wasting your money.
